Habit Tracker Feature Missing Key Functionality
I've been a dedicated user of Lift/Coach.me for over ten years, but I'm concerned about the app's future, particularly the Habit Tracker feature that I've valued highly. Recently, I've encountered significant issues: on my iPhone, attempting to add a new habit results in an "Error loading results" message. On the web app, while search results do appear, the option to add a new, undefined habit is absent. This limits users to adding only pre-existing habits, which is problematic if you're trying to add a habit with a slightly different name. I hope this feedback reaches the development team and that these issues can be addressed promptly. I'm aware that the original founder stepped down in 2022, and I extend my best wishes to the new management. I hope they continue the legacy of diligent bug fixes and app improvements.
